Output 6efaf9c1c65b870376332156dc777a98a253d62182718a883eaaf985336490af:1

value
80413898
script pubkey
OP_0 OP_PUSHBYTES_32 66bb6f1f53b32e42dbfd31d1b9af3f320bb7e9ee2e7e18c106c2e1f72dde60f7
address
bc1qv6ak786nkvhy9klax8gmntelxg9m060w9elp3sgxctslwtw7vrms6swsy8
transaction
6efaf9c1c65b870376332156dc777a98a253d62182718a883eaaf985336490af
spent
true